The Background of the Legal Dispute

The legal dispute between Grayscale and Osprey arose from a significant challenge faced by Grayscale. The company had been working towards converting its flagship Bitcoin Trust into a Bitcoin ETF, a move that many in the financial community have deemed crucial for the legitimacy and broader acceptance of cryptocurrencies. However, Osprey, which launched its Bitcoin ETF just a year ago, felt that Grayscale’s attempts could potentially undermine their own product.

In August 2021, Osprey filed a lawsuit against Grayscale in a Connecticut court, arguing that Grayscale’s actions were deceptive and could mislead investors. Osprey claimed that Grayscale’s efforts to gain approval for its Bitcoin ETF came at the expense of Osprey’s already established presence in the ETF market. As both firms engaged in legal wrangling, the implications of this litigation loomed large over the cryptocurrency ecosystem.

Key Elements of the Resolution

On October 11, 2023, both Grayscale and Osprey announced that they had reached a resolution to their ongoing legal dispute. While the specifics of the agreement are not fully disclosed, here are some key elements that can be gathered from available sources:

  • Both companies have agreed to discontinue any ongoing litigation, allowing them to focus on their respective businesses and product offerings without the distraction of legal contention.
  • Details surrounding any financial settlements have not been publicly disclosed, but the resolution indicates a mutual understanding to collaborate, if possible, rather than continue a divisive legal battle.
  • The move towards resolution is seen as a positive sign for investors, signaling that both firms can coexist in the expanding ETF market.
